My #1 favorite video game story of all time. Hell, it's my favorite fictional story period. There isn't a single weak aspect to it. From the very first frame of this masterpiece, not a single second is wasted on fluff or excess. Absolutely everything ties in to James' or one of the supporting characters' stories in one way or another, as symbolism can be found everywhere. Ambiguous deep holes recur, generating a sense of unease, helplessness, uncertainty, recklessness, and sexual innuendo. Bars and gates constantly separate James from his goals and progression, emphasizing the divide between others and him, as well as his memories from reality. Of course, monsters found throughout the game constantly remind James of sex & promiscuity, but also sickness and writhing plague, transforming beauty into pain and disgust. Pyramid Head, James' own self-fashioned torturer and executor, is the primary antagonistic force, but also a hero in disguise, forcibly making James come to the realization of what actually transpired between him and his wife before the events of the game.

Characters at once feel real & dream-like at the same time; broken, incompatible strangers meeting in passing as they each struggle with intense demons and vicious pasts that have led them to the town of Silent Hill in one way or another. They help mirror aspect of James' psyche while still telling compelling, rich stories in their own rights. Angela's history of sexual abuse from her own family is disturbing and insidiously complex, as you directly encounter Angela's own-self monster in the form of twisted lumps of flesh on a bedframe. Eddie's history of bullying and violent revenge illustrates the more destructive parts of James' personality, while encapsulating the feelings of millions of disenfranchised and lonely teens around the country. And Laura, who represents the innocence and kindness still left in the world and inside James as well. The voice acting and motion-capture makes each encounter with these characters kinetic, strange, off-kilter and most importantly, memorable. To me, its why the game endures as much as it has due to the uniqueness of the performances. It's something that keeps the tone of RE '96 alive while transforming it into something artful, that compellingly plays into the story and characters.

There are many times I've played SH2, and never once have I found the journey an easy one to digest. It's meant different things to me at different times, and has played on my own fears and insecurities in ways that has shocked, surprised and disgusted me. To me, Silent Hill 2 is a masterwork of art because of this, this malleable force of nature that changes along with me through relatably flawed characters, a strong evocative, emotional musical score, and thematic elements which are direct components of the human condition. Unlocking its secrets only pushes others deeper, and this enigmatic psychological aspect baked into the game's very execution in its plotting and pacing will forever make each subsequent journey only that much more meaningful.

This isn't a positive. Silent Hill 2 is an extremely personal journey, and it hurts the experience when you can recognize the VA from 5 million other things.

Guy Cihi (James' VA) said that when he first heard the new VA, his immediate reaction was that they're so much more professional than him, but after some reflection, came to the conclusion that they're too 'Hollywood' for Silent Hill 2. SH2's cast is full of awkward weirdos, not professionals. It's a take I 100% agree with.

No, though it is the same setting. 3 is more of a true follow-up to Silent Hill.

Also 9. Its the best story from that era. There are some technical elements holding it back slightly like the voice acting, but on the whole its excellent. The thing that really struck me was that while we do see stories like this these days in indie games, this was a AAA game. You would never have that these days. Silent Hill never sold that much though, and so it became a casualty of rising costs in development. A shame, the production values added to the storytelling.

Same here! I always appreciated how different SH locations were from RE. RE always had a sense of unrealistic bombast to their locations. Extremely memorable and great, yes, but having locations based in realism and logic made it seem like this could be something that could happen to you. And when the Otherworld shifted in twisted the logic established it genuinely created the feel of a nightmare unfolding before you.
